Frequently Asked Questions (FAQs)
What is tungsten carbide and why is it used in manufacturing dies?
Tungsten carbide is a durable and hard material made from tungsten and carbon. It’s widely used in manufacturing dies because of its exceptional hardness, wear resistance, and ability to withstand high temperatures. This makes it ideal for producing precision tools and components that require longevity and reliability.
How are tungsten carbide dies manufactured?
Tungsten carbide dies are typically manufactured through a process called powder metallurgy. This involves mixing tungsten carbide powder with a binder, pressing it into shape, and then sintering it at high temperatures to create a solid, dense die. This process ensures high precision and durability.
